Algo’s Dembo joins Prmia ‘blue ribbon panel’

Ron Dembo, founder and president of Algorithmics, the Canadian risk management software and advisory company, has joined the ‘blue ribbon panel” of advisors to the Professional Risk Managers’ International Association (Prmia).

The panel advises the board of Prmia on its development as a grass-roots professional association, and comprises leading figures in the risk management profession. It includes representatives from professional associations including the International Association of Financial Engineers and the International Swaps and Derivatives Association.

Chairman of the panel is Bob Mark, president of Black Diamond Consulting and former head of risk management at Canadian bank CIBC.
